**Key Ceremony Checklist — Item 7:** Before sealing the signing keys for the Marivel Checkout release, confirm the load test against the staging checkout flow has completed: 5,000 concurrent carts sustained for twenty minutes with error rates under 0.2%. Record the test run number in the ceremony log, then verify the escrow card below matches the witness copy.

strongbox words: norwyn-wenael-aldvan-aldiel-wendor-holael

## Who to ping about GiftNote

Welcome aboard! GiftNote is our donation-receipt mailer for the Larchfield Fund. Template tweaks go to the comms folks; delivery failures and bounce weirdness go to the platform crew. Don't push template changes on Fridays — receipts batch over the weekend. For anything GiftNote-related, start with the address below.

billing contact of kaweg-tajeg = drudor.lamion.oliath@torvalabs.test

## Deployment

The Lumacache image service has a known slow leak in its thumbnail cache layer: evicted entries keep a reference alive through the decoder pool, so resident memory creeps up roughly 40 MB per hour under steady load. Until the refactor in the Harkness branch lands, we mitigate by capping pool size and scheduling a rolling restart every 12 hours. Deploy with the supervisor, never bare, or the restart hook won't fire. The deployment relies on the configuration values listed below.

settings of bagug-tahof:
holath:
  pin: 7837
  metrics_host: metrics.holath.tolvaqsys.internal
  tenant: quenath
  seal: seal_6001b3af